Whatever happened to Nexus Blitz?

Announcement for Team Fight Tactic got me thinking - whatever happened to nexus blitz? The game mode was fast paced and fun, so for the most part I really thought it would be a stapled addition to the game. It had been months since it was taken out and now a new, permanent game mode is added in its stead?
